Official Signing of Memorandum of understanding
between International Code Council and
Housing and Building Research Center
( USA September 2003 )
Due to constant technological changes and the growth and opening of the global economies,
the borders of countries tend to dissipate generating and accentuating commercial and cultural
exchanges. This s turn has determined the need to unity criteria for the quality and control of
construction products and system.
The mission of Housing and Building Research Center (HBRC) is to enhance the performance of
the building sector in the Arab Republic of Egypt through scientific research and development
of building codes and construction materials specifications.
The mission of the International Code council (ICC) is to promulgate a comprehensive and
compatible regulatory system for the built environment, through consistent performance-based
regulations that are effective, efficient and meet government, industry and public needs.
Under this Memorandum of understanding, the two organizations recognize the need to study and
evaluate existing conditions to jointly reach conclusions that address various issues and
concerns, having the main objective public safety through the preservation of human life while
improving the social aspect. A significant part of the conclusions will address how the
organizations can effectively work together.
During the event of official signing of the Mov, Prof. Omaima Salah El-Din, the chairperson of
HBRC presents a talk about the main activities of the Housing Ministry through the mechanism
of modernization of Egypt and the role of HBRC in field of codes preparation and codes enforcement.
